Top Wuxia Games on iOS in Africa: Q1 2023 Performance
Discover the performance of the top 5 Wuxia games on iOS in Africa for Q1 2023, including key metrics such as we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the first quarter of 2023, the top five Wuxia games on iOS in Africa demonstrated varied performance across key metrics such as we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a detailed look at how these games fared:
Immortal Taoists-idle Games saw a fluctuating weekly revenue trend, peaking at $288 in early February and closing the quarter at $142. Weekly downloads showed a notable rise mid-quarter with 211 downloads in early January but experienced a dip to 67 by mid-March, before rebounding to 156 in the final week. The game maintained a stable user base, with active users peaking at 441 in mid-January and ending the quarter at 390.
Crasher: Nirvana, released in late February, showed a gradual increase in weekly revenue, starting at $21 in early March and rising to $52 by the end of the quarter. Downloads began at 52 in the release week but declined to 3 by the last week of March.
Perfect World Mobile had a mixed performance. Weekly revenue saw significant fluctuations, reaching a high of $310 in late January and dropping to $79 by the end of March. Weekly downloads remained mostly low, with minor peaks of 9 and 7 downloads in mid-January and late March, respectively.
Yong Heroes experienced a sharp decline in weekly revenue, starting at $522 at the end of December and falling to $10 by mid-January. Downloads were minimal, with a peak of 26 in early January. Active users were recorded only once, at 33 in early January.
Monster Awaken had minimal activity with negligible downloads and no recorded revenue. The highest download count was 19 in early February.
